Tyr: Chains of Valhalla is an indie action platform video game developed by Mexican indie studio Ennui Studio. It was released for PlayStation 4 and Microsoft Windows on Steam on May 8, 2018.[1][2]

Gameplay

Inspired by Contra and Mega Man X, players must shoot enemies and complete difficult platforming challenges to finish a stage. The twist is that the player has only one hour (game time) to complete all stages. Rather than giving you several lives, the game has no death other than running out of time. You can use chips earned after defeating a boss to unlock passive upgrades and make each subsequent attempt faster.[3]

Plot

The game follows Tyr, creation of Professor Oswald Din, armored with Gungnir, the weapon of the Gods, and Huggin & Munnin, a duo of AI that serves as comic relief and helps with the mission to prevent Lemuz Oki from destroying the world order and creating a new realm of chaos to seize the biggest technology company and control the entire world.[2]

Development

Tyr: Chains of Valhalla began development after a crowdfunding campaign on Kickstarter in the fall of 2017.[3]

The idea behind the game was due to the director's belief that Capcom had ceased to make enough Mega Man titles, and that he and other fans desired more of the same type of gameplay.[3]

The developer's main focus was on the gamefeel and getting it to play in a similar manner to Mega Man but retaining a vision of extreme difficulty from the early Contra series. The most difficult aspect in developing the game was the studio's little experience with consoles or Steam releases, it being their first non-mobile-based game. [3]

Soundtrack

The game's soundtrack was composed by Andrew Sitkov and includes Power Metal elements.[4]

Reception

Tyr: Chains of Valhalla received "mixed or average" reviews.[5][6][7] While many praised the soundtrack and visual elements of the game, several found that the unresponsive controls and the lack of a proper introduction made it a more difficult than enjoyable experience. The studio released a patch exactly one month later after release to address these issues.[8] They also published a demo to try to convince the community to try their fixed game,[9] which had some moderate success in improving players' perceptions afterward.[10][11]
